Mount Pleasant – Alvin Robert Madisen, age 88, passed away peacefully in his sleep at home early Friday, October 29, 2021.

Alvin was born in Racine, WI on September 11, 1933 to the late George and Marion (nee: DeWolf) Madisen. Following graduation from Washington Park High School, Alvin faithfully served our country with the United States Navy during the Korean War from 1955-1957. On April 30, 1966 he was united in marriage with the love of his life, Jenese Arlene (nee: Whartman). Sadly, Janese passed away in 1991.

Alvin began his working career with Paris Royal Cleaners before becoming a successful salesman with Badger Uniform, from where he retired. He was quite the accomplished bowler, having won a whole $300 on the television show “Bowling for Dollars” years ago. He was an all-around professional & college sports fan – especially of the Green Bay Packers. He also enjoyed working outside in his yard. Above all, Alvin loved spending time with his entire family.

Surviving are his son, Timothy (Elizabeth “Liz”) Burris; daughter, Judith Smart; grandchildren, Carl (Julia) Burris, Joshua (Melissa) Burris, Tracy Bogie, Carol Bogie, Lisa (Brandon) Schroeder, Jennifer Bogie, Nicole Smart and Ian Smart; great-grandchildren, Fiona, Addison, Delaney, Leon, Seth, Emma, Kathryn, Teagan, Kerthan, Dylan, Jael, Scarlett, Caden & Tabitha; sister, Geraldine Dundon; sister-in-law, Mary Jane Madisen; devoted nephew & nieces, Rusty (Charlotte) Buck, Marianne (William) Eyman and Ginger Siever; other nieces, nephews, relatives & friends.

In addition to his parents & wife, Alvin was preceded in death by his sisters, Alice (Donald) Miller and Gloria (Nick) Motto; and brother, Clayton Madisen and daughter, Patricia “Patsy” Bogie.
